Blue

If your team number appears for one of these student tasks, your team is responsible for that task on the day assigned (see Course Requirements for more info). If there is a problem with your team completing an assigned task, please arrange a swap with another team, and then email the staff with the update.

  • C: Cleanup. During the last 30 minutes lab is open. Your job is to clean the lab and shop at the direction of a staff member. Please find a staff member 30 minutes before lab closes in the 6.002 lab.
  • S: Mock contest setup. Help setup for the mock contest, beginning at 12:00 noon. Please find a staff member assigned to the mock contest (MC) at 12:00 noon in the 6.001 lab.
  • T: Mock contest teardown. Help teardown the mock contest, beginning at 5:00. Please find a staff member assigned to the mock contest (MC) at 5:00 in 26-100.
  • SS: Sponsor dinner setup. Help setup for the sponsor dinner, beginning at 4:00 pm. Please find a staff member assigned to the Sponsor Dinner (SD) in the 6.001 lab at 4:00 pm.
  • ST: Sponsor dinner teardown. Help teardown the sponsor dinner, beginning once the dinner is over (about 8:00 pm). Please find a staff member assigned to the Sponsor Dinner (SD) in the Grier room once the dinner is over.
  • CT: Contest teardown. Help teardown the contest, beginning once the contest is over (about 6:30 pm). Please find a staff member once the contest is over.
